  While this isn't the recommend way to generate such a large suer/password 
database (Some form of Ldap/SQL is) You can use the $include directive to 
include a different file for users.  Using an older version of freeradius, we 
do that for a small group that we don't have in our /etc/passwd files.  It 
works quite well for what you are asking.
